Why visit Malmö for the day?

Malmö is a youthful coastal city known for Turning Torso, historic squares and a diverse food scene. It blends Scandinavian design with a relaxed local atmosphere shaped by parks, waterfronts and international influences.

Why visit Helsingborg for the day?

Helsingborg is a coastal city in southern Sweden, known for Kärnan, its seafront and views across the Öresund to Denmark. It combines medieval roots and green spaces such as Sofiero with a relaxed modern centre.

Walking Around in Lund

Lund is a fairly small city and most of its major attractions can be found within a short distance of each other in the city center. Walking is the easiest way to take in the sites of Lund in a short amount of time. Start your walk in the Botaniska trädgården which is Lund's botanic garden and is home to over 7,000 different species of plants. Wander at your leisure through the magnificent gardens before heading out on Tunavagen Street towards the Kulturen Museum. This open-air museum houses buildings dating from the Middle Ages through to the 1930s. Guided tours are available or you can wander around the museum at your own pace. Take the Kulturen entrance to the Lundagård park and explore the delightfully shaded walkways of the park on your way to the Lund Cathedral. This magnificent building was built in 1080 and is now the seat of the Bishop of Lund of the Church of Sweden. Stop to take a walk through this ancient building that was once a Roman Catholic cathedral and was a key part of the reformation in Sweden. Afterward, head to a nearby cafe to enjoy a well-deserved cake and coffee.
